Best time to go to Gairloch Heritage Museum

The best time to visit Gairloch Heritage Museum is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.6°F (4.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
February40.6°F (4.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
March42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May48.9°F (9.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ighAverage
August55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ighAverage
September53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ighAverage
October49.6°F (9.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
November45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ly High
